Clinton County Marriage Records (Michigan)

A Clinton County Marriage License Office issues marriage certificates and maintains marriage records for a county or local government in Clinton County, MI. These documents include information on the couple's marriage, such as names, parents' names, dates of birth, the location of the wedding, the date of the wedding, and the officiant and witnesses. These Clinton County marriage records may be required for legally changing a name, applying for spousal benefits, and accessing other government services. Many Marriage License Offices issue certified Clinton County marriage certificates, which can often be requested online, and they may also hold copies of marriage license applications. These records can be useful for legal purposes and for genealogical research.
